CDN和域名配置
一、选择合适的CDN服务商
1、覆盖范围和节点数量:确保CDN服务商拥有广泛的全球节点分布,以便用户无论身处何地都能快速访问内容,Akamai和Cloudflare在全球范围内都有大量节点。
2、服务质量和稳定性:选择有良好声誉和稳定服务记录的提供商,可以通过查看SLA(服务级别协议)和用户评价来评估其服务质量。
3、价格和套餐:根据自身需求和预算选择合适的套餐,注意是否有隐藏费用或流量限制。
4、功能和特性:不同的CDN服务商提供不同的功能,如流媒体加速、SSL证书支持、安全防护等,根据具体需求选择适合的服务商。
二、注册并登录账户
1、创建账户:访问CDN服务商官网,找到注册页面,填写必要信息,创建账户。
2、验证账户:某些服务商可能要求你验证邮箱或手机号码,按照提示完成验证步骤。
3、登录后台管理系统:使用注册的账户和密码登录服务商提供的后台管理系统。
三、添加域名和配置DNS
1、添加域名:在CDN服务商的控制面板中,找到“添加域名”或类似选项,输入你想要加速的域名。
2、配置CNAME记录:CDN服务商会提供一个CNAME记录,你需要将这个记录添加到你的DNS管理系统中,登录你的域名注册商或DNS服务提供商,找到DNS设置页面,添加一条新的CNAME记录,将你的域名指向CDN提供的域名。
3、等待DNS生效:DNS记录的生效时间取决于TTL(生存时间)设置,通常需要几分钟到几小时。
四、设置缓存规则
1、缓存时间:设置不同类型内容的缓存时间(如HTML、CSS、JS、图片等),确定多久更新一次缓存。
2、缓存策略:CDN服务商通常提供多种缓存策略,如基于文件扩展名、路径、查询参数等,根据你的需求选择合适的策略。
3、强制刷新:如果你的网站内容更新频繁,可以设置强制刷新规则,确保用户访问的内容是最新的。
4、自定义缓存规则:根据具体需求,某些服务商允许你自定义缓存规则,比如特定路径或文件类型的缓存策略。
五、性能监控和优化
1、使用监控工具:大多数CDN服务商提供内置的监控工具,你可以实时查看流量、命中率、响应时间等数据。
2、分析日志:通过分析日志文件,了解用户访问行为,发现并解决潜在问题。
3、优化配置:根据监控数据,调整缓存规则和其他配置,以达到最佳性能。
六、常见问题及解决方法
1、DNS解析错误:检查你的CNAME记录是否正确,确保DNS设置已经生效。
2、缓存未更新:检查缓存规则和强制刷新设置,确保内容及时更新。
3、访问速度慢:检查CDN节点的覆盖范围和服务质量,可能需要更换服务商或升级套餐。
4、安全问题:启用SSL证书和其他安全防护措施,确保数据传输安全。
七、归纳
通过以上步骤,你可以成功将域名地址添加到CDN并进行相关配置,有效提升网站的访问速度和用户体验,选择合适的CDN服务商、正确配置DNS和缓存规则是关键,每一步都需要仔细操作,确保万无一失,如果需要更精细的项目管理和协作,可以考虑使用研发项目管理系统PingCode和通用项目协作软件Worktile,它们可以帮助你更好地管理和优化CDN项目。
各位小伙伴们,我刚刚为大家分享了有关“cdn和域名怎么配置”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1403630.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复